West after disintegration of Muslim states: Cleric

The latest effort to divide an Islamic country made in Iraq while the Western countries were to divide Iraqi Kurdistan from the country through the Sept 2017 referendum, Ayatollah Mohsen Qomi, deputy head of the Supreme Leader's office, said in this northeastern Iranian city.

At present, Western countries want to implement their plan in Syria, Qomi said at an Islamic gathering held in Mashad.

The Ayatollah went on to say that the important question of today's Islamic World is preservation of unity among the Islamic Ummah.

Ulema should play active role in culturalizing the goals of the Islamic Ummah, the senior cleric added.

Deputy head of Afghanistan's seminary Ayatollah Muhammad Hashem Salehi Modaress, who also participated in the Mashad meeting, stressed the importance of preserving unity among the Islamic Ummah.

The Afghan cleric said the enemy cannot hurt Islam as long as the Islamic Ummah is united.

The two-day scientific meeting on the Islamic civilization and the role of Afghan Ulema in the Islamic activities started work in Mashad, Khorasan Razavi Province, on Tuesday.
